Claus Lindbjerg Andersen from Aarhus University and Aarhus University Hospital has just received DKK 1.8 million for a major new research project which it is hoped can ensure earlier detection of colon and bowel cancer so that more patients survive.

Daniel Witte has just been appointed as professor at the Department of Public Health, Aarhus University. Here he will continue his research into diabetes.

Professor and medical specialist in general practice Mogens Vestergaard from Aarhus University has been chosen as the new chair of the Committee on General Practice and Family Medicine Research of the Novo Nordisk Foundation.

From 1 January it is easier for researchers and PhD students from non-EU/EEA countries to obtain permission to work and conduct research in Denmark

A new DKK 60 million research project being run from Denmark will study why up to half of all diabetics suffer from painful neuritis. The project is the largest in this field so far.
